How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to San Bernardino Damage Experts initiates rapid deployment. We gather crucial details about the water intrusion to dispatch the right team immediately. Our 24/7 service is ready.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our IICRC-certified techn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ely locate all water damage. This comprehensive assessment guides our restoration strategy, ensuring no hidden moisture remains.
3
Water Extraction
Powerful industrial extractors remove standing water quickly. This critical step prevents further saturation and reduces drying time, preparing the area for thorough dehumidification and sanitization.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
High-velocity air movers and commercial dehumidifiers dry affected structures and contents. We monitor humidity levels daily, preventing mold growth and preserving your property's integrity.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ated areas are thoroughly cleaned, disinfected, and deodorized using EPA-approved solutions. This eliminates bacteria and odors,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you.
6
Final Inspection
A meticulous final inspection confirms complete dryness and restoration. We walk you through the restored areas, ensuring your satisfaction with our work. Your property is ready.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ost in Twentynine Palms, CA

The cost of Commercial Water Damage Rest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Twentynine Palms, CA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can vary depending on your specific situation. Call us for a free estimate to get a more accurate qu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and equipment needed
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and complexity of repairs
Mold Remediation $1,500 - $7,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and extent of mold growth
